雙解釋義
- [C]柵欄,籬笆; 圍墻 a thing like a wall that is made of pieces of wood or mental
- vt. 圍以柵欄 surround, divide, provide with a fence or fences
- vt. 束縛 enclose
- vt. & vi. 保護,防御,周旋 protect (sb/sth)

常用短語
- fence month
-
-
禁獵期 a period time that hunting is not permitted
- mend (one's) fences
-
-
修復友好關系; 消釋前嫌 remove the bad efforts of one's former actions, for example, by becoming friendly with a person one has offended
- fence from (v.+prep.)
-
-
為…筑籬笆以阻擋 enclose or surround (sth) with a fence to prevent (sth)
fence sth from sthThey fenced the seedbeds from the north wind.
他(ta)們為苗床筑(zhu)籬(li)擋住北風。
- fence in (v.+adv.)
-
-
包圍; 圍困,限制 surround or limit (sb/sth)
- fence off (v.+adv.)
-
-
擋開,抵擋住,對付 fight against; deal with (sth)
- fence out (v.+adv.)
-
-
阻止…進入 keep (usually animals) out with a fence; prevent (sb) from entering a group or activity
fence sb ? outThe sheep keep wandering into the vegetable field so we shall have to fence them out.
羊不斷地(di)往菜地(di)里跑,我們得用(yong)柵欄把它(ta)們攔在外面。
We don't want that awkward man on the committee, do what you can to fence him out.
我們不愿那笨(ben)蛋加入委員會; 你要盡力阻止他。
- fence with (v.+prep.)
-
-
巧妙地與(某人)進行辯論 argue skillfully with (sb)
fence sth with sthThe farmer fenced his land with wire.
農場主用鐵絲把他的土地圍了起來。
His land is fenced with barbed wire.
他的(de)田地四周圍(wei)有(you)帶刺(ci)的(de)鐵絲網。
fence with sb/sthI should like the chance to fence with a worthier opponent.
我很想找(zhao)機(ji)會(hui)跟(gen)一個水平相當的(de)對手擊(ji)劍。
Shall we fence with long or short swords?
我們是(shi)用(yong)長劍還(huan)是(shi)用(yong)短劍斗?
fence with sbMembers of Parliament enjoy fencing with each other on questions which they disagree.
下院議(yi)員喜(xi)歡(huan)就(jiu)意見相(xiang)左的問(wen)題進(jin)行(xing)辯論。
The governor was an expert at fencing with reporters.
這位州(zhou)長(chang)是搪塞新聞記(ji)者(zhe)的高手。
